Each day, an estimated 8 million pieces of plastic … Webhave funded the construction of salt interception schemes. These schemes prevent approximately half a million tonnes of salt per year from reaching the River Murray. WebOct 30, 2024 · The carbon effect of river interception is also characterized by the carbon burial of the reservoir. The conservative estimate of this flux is 40–50 Tg year −1 (estimated from Vörösmarty et al. 2003), which may be similar to the estimation of carbon emissions from reservoirs (Barros et al. 2011).
